Why Cold Compress For Wisdom Tooth Pain Is Necessary
When my wisdom tooth started hurting, I quickly learned that a cold compress can make a big difference. I use it because the cold helps numb the area, which gives me fast relief from the throbbing pain. It also helps reduce swelling, and that matters a lot when the gums around the wisdom tooth feel sore, tight, or inflamed.
I also find that a cold compress is a simple and safe first step before trying anything stronger. I just wrap ice in a cloth and place it on my cheek for short periods, and it helps me feel more comfortable without irritating the painful area. It does not fix the tooth problem itself, but it makes the pain easier to manage while I wait for proper treatment.
For me, the biggest reason it is necessary is that wisdom tooth pain can get worse when swelling builds up. The cold helps slow that swelling down, which can ease pressure and make it easier for me to eat, talk, and rest. When I am dealing with wisdom tooth pain, a cold compress is one of the easiest ways I know to get short-term relief.

How I Use It for Best Results
When my wisdom tooth hurts, I usually apply the cold compress to the outside of my cheek for about 15 to 20 minutes at a time. I take breaks in between so I do not overdo it. I also keep a cloth between the ice pack and my skin if it feels too cold. This helps me stay comfortable while still getting relief.

Final Thoughts
I’ve found that using a cold compress for wisdom tooth pain can be a simple and effective way to reduce swelling and ease discomfort. My best takeaway is that it works well as a short-term relief method, especially when paired with proper oral care and rest. If the pain becomes severe or doesn’t improve, I know it’s important to check with a dentist for further treatment.
